Managing Your Money: A Budgeting Primer
Taking control of your finances can seem daunting, but it doesn't have to be. A well-planned budget is a cornerstone to reaching your financial objectives. , Begin by tracking your income and expenses for one weeks. This will show you where your money is spent.
- After you have a clear understanding of your spending habits, you can create an budget that allocates your money effectively.
- Establish achievable budgetary goals, such as accumulating for retirement, relieving off debt, or purchasing a home.
- Assess your budget periodically and make adjustments as needed. Circumstances can change, so it's important to maintain your budget versatile.

Debt Management Strategies: Get Back on Track tackle
Feeling overwhelmed by debt can be a stressful experience, but it's important to remember that you're not alone. Quite a few people struggle with debt at some point in their lives. The good news is that there are effective debt management strategies you can here utilize to regain control of your finances and strive for financial stability. A key first step is to develop a budget that accurately reflects your income and expenses. This will help you identify areas where you can trim spending and free up more cash flow to allocate towards debt repayment.
- Another beneficial strategy is to merge your debts into a single loan with a lower interest rate. This can simplify your monthly payments and potentially save you money on interest charges over time.
- Converse with your creditors to see if they are willing to decrease your interest rates or dismiss late fees. Being transparent about your financial situation can often lead to positive outcomes.
- Considering professional guidance from a credit counselor or debt management agency can also be invaluable. They can provide personalized advice, help you develop a feasible repayment plan, and represent you throughout the process.
Remember, getting back on track financially is a journey that takes time and commitment. By implementing these debt management strategies, you can create positive changes, minimize your stress levels, and work towards a brighter financial future.
